Abstract

The utility model relates to a sliding door anti-bouncing structure with a damper, comprising a shifting block fixing plate which is fixed in a rail on a sliding door and a damper fixing plate which is fixed on the upper side of the sliding door; the structure is characterized in that the shifting block fixing plate is provided with a protruded guide rail; the damper fixing plate is provided with an anti-bouncing pulley component; and a pulley in the anti-bounding pulley component slides along the guide rail. The utility model has the beneficial effects that: 1. the pulley of the anti-bouncing pulley component slides on the guide rail of the shifting block fixing plate, can effectively buffer the inertia of the sliding door, so that the sliding door moves stably; 2. the height of the adjusting pulley can be adjusted for the installation on doors with different specifications; and 3. the structure is simple, and the production and manufacturing are convenient.

[background technology]
At present; on the sliding door of furniture, generally all used damper; and the shifting block of in the getting on the right track of sliding door, installing of stirring damper; when the promotion sliding door keeps to the side; shifting block is stuck on the movable part of damper; driving sliding door slowly moves; up to the frame next door that rests in door; because the cushioning effect of damper; make sliding door near not bumping in the doorframe, avoid sending noise, or even the protection sliding door can be not therefore and damaged in collision because of collision; therefore, quite be subjected to liking of customer.
Yet, when people overexert or strength is excessive promotion sliding door and since this moment sliding door inertia bigger, the moment that shifting block cooperates with damper, the phenomenon that one side of sliding door can occur upwards jumping produces noise, also easily makes the return pulley of sliding door break away from track when serious.
Therefore, the utility model is further improved prior art at above-mentioned deficiency.

[specific embodiment]
As shown in the figure, the anti-jump structure of a kind of sliding door of the utility model indication with damper, comprise shifting block fixed head 1 and the damper fixed head 2 that is fixed on the sliding door top in being fixed on sliding door gets on the right track, described shifting block fixed head 1 is provided with the guide rail 3 of protrusion, device has anti-jump pulley assembly 4 on the described damper fixed head 2, pulley 5 in the described anti-jump pulley assembly 4 slides along guide rail 3, and it is more steady that sliding door is moved.
In the present embodiment, described anti-jump pulley assembly 4 also includes installing plate 6, holder 7, torsion spring 8 and set screw 9, described installing plate 6 is fixed on the damper fixed head 2, and on installing plate 6, be provided with and install and fix seat 7 rotating shaft 10, holder 7 can 10 be rotated around the shaft, and the front end of described holder 7 is installed pulley 5, and the tail end of described holder 7 is provided with skewback 11, described torsion spring 8 is enclosed within the rotating shaft 10, and skewback 11 1 ends of holder 7 are popped up; Described set screw 9 is passed installing plate 6 and is withstood the skewback 11 that pops up.
The two ends of guide rail 3 described in the utility model are provided with buffering inclined-plane 11, are convenient to pulley 5 and slide to guide rail 3 from buffering inclined-plane 11.
The utility model in use, can regulate by the height of 9 pairs of pulleys 5 of set screw, make sliding door move to shifting block fixed head 1 below the time, pulley 5 can move along guide rail 3, it can effectively cushion the inertia of sliding door, thereby sliding door is moved stably.
